The school was established in year 2008 and it is a Co-educational located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Department of Education. The school is situated in 130 Bisalpur assembly constituency. This is primarily Hindi medium school.
The institution has strength of around three hundred students being taught by around 3 teachers. The student-teacher ratio is 71 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Two teachers are Male and remaining one is Female. In terms of Academic qualification one teacher is Below Graduate and rest two are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 24:1, means on an average twenty four students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 130 students in class I to V and 82 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has pucca boundary walls. The school has total nine clasrooms and one other room. The school has two desktops and one printer in its premises. There is both library and book bank for students. There are two boys toilets and two girls toilets for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
